Title: The Innovations of Susumu Hirase
Introduction
Susumu Hirase is a notable inventor based in Kobe,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of chemistry, particularly in the development of amino acid derivatives. His work has implications in various scientific and industrial applications.
Latest Patents
Hirase holds a patent for a process for preparing 2-amino malonic acid derivatives and 2-amino-1,3-propanediol derivatives. This patent outlines a method for synthesizing these compounds, which are valuable in the production of pharmaceuticals and other chemical products. He has 1 patent to his name, showcasing his innovative approach to chemical synthesis.
